Myth 1: You should wait on a rescue prior to relocating an injured person

This is among the most unsafe misconceptions in everyday incidents. People often think motion equates to making points even worse, so they postpone any type of relocation. Reality is more nuanced. If an injured individual is in immediate danger from website traffic, fire, or collapse, relocating them very carefully to safety is proper. Likewise, if proceeded positioning compromises breathing or flow, a modification is necessary. On the various other hand, if a person has suspected spinal injury and is stable where they are, marginal motion is typically ideal till paramedics show up. Myth 2: If you are not sure whether to call triple zero telephone call later on or after a while

The correct approach is to call 000 quickly when there is any type of uncertainty regarding lethal problems. Indications consist of serious bleeding, unconsciousness or altered level of awareness, problem breathing, breast pain, thought stroke, or severe allergies. Emergency situation dispatchers can guide by phone and maintain you acting till paramedics arrive. Postponing the phone call because you wish the scenario will enhance can set you back beneficial time. Myth 3: CPR is only for grownups and only if the person has actually stopped breathing

image

CPR and basic resuscitation methods vary by age, yet chest compressions and rescue breaths can be lifesaving for babies, kids, and grownups. For sufferers that are less competent and not breathing generally, CPR must begin promptly. For youngsters, rescuers make use of gentler compression deepness and different hand placement. Many individuals assume that "not taking a breath" need to mean complete cessation of any breath, but agonal gasps or irregular breathing patterns are not effective breathing. Identifying inefficient breathing and starting CPR quicker improves results. Myth 4: You need costly devices to manage serious bleeding

Severe blood loss can often be handled efficiently with methods instructed in common courses. Direct pressure with a tidy clothing, elevation of the arm or leg when appropriate, and pressure bandaging can regulate most bleeding. Training covers when to apply a tourniquet and how to do so safely. While a correct commercial tourniquet is optimal, improvisated ones can be lifesaving in severe scenarios if applied properly. Myth 5: Only clinically qualified people need to make use of an AED

Automated external defibrillators are created for layman use and include voice prompts and security features that lower the risk of harm. Onlookers trained in CPR and AED utilize markedly raise the opportunity of survival in abrupt cardiac arrest. Public gain access to AEDs are significantly present in work environments, going shopping centres, and showing off centers around Jandakot. Handling side instances and trade-offs

First aid usually needs judgment phone calls rather than rigorous policies. For example, with a thought broken leg: splinting is important, however moving https://josuehpzd988.yousher.com/exactly-how-first-aid-and-cpr-jandakot-courses-advantage-local-business the individual could boost discomfort or create further injury if done approximately. In remote settings around Jandakot where ambulance reaction might take longer, improvised splints and cautious tracking end up being more vital. For severe allergies, epinephrine autoinjectors provide rapid symptom control, yet training covers when to provide and the demand to still call emergency services. During a CPR occasion, bystander tiredness is real; exchanging compressors every 2 minutes maintains compression quality. Excellent training discusses these trade-offs and methods multi-rescuer coordination so shifts are smooth.

Misconception list: four common myths corrected

    Myth: Mouth-to-mouth is always required. Truth: Hands-only CPR works for adult unexpected heart attack and is more effective for untrained bystanders; rescue breaths stay vital for kids and some non-cardiac causes of arrest. Myth: If a person is breathing they do not require aid. Fact: Abnormal or poor breathing can call for immediate intervention and monitoring; breathing distress can degrade quickly. Myth: Just professionals need to touch someone with upper body discomfort. Reality: Immediate spectator assessment, calling emergency situation services, and offering aspirin when recommended by send off or protocol can be lifesaving. Myth: A tourniquet will certainly cause limb loss. Truth: Effectively applied tourniquets in serious hemorrhage conserve lives, and arm or leg loss from a tourniquet is rare compared to fatality from unchecked bleeding.
